Lesson 7.

Verbs.

New words.

taberu - to eat
nomu - to drink
suru - to do
iku - to go
kuru - to come
ashita - tomorrow
kyou - today
nani - what
doko - where



//Simple Sentences

We'll look at the making simple sentences with these verbs.

John ha hamburger o taberu. - John eats a hamburger.

lit. (John subject hamburger direct object eats.)

Kyle ha beer o nomu. - Kyle drinks beer.

lit. (Kyle subject beer direct objects drinks.)

Chris ha judo o suru. - Chris does judo.

Ashita, watashi ha dojo he iku. - Tomorrow, I will go to the dojo.

Kyou, Kyle ha dojo he kuru. - Kyle will come to the dojo today.


//Simple Questions

You can also create questions with these verbs.

Chris ha judo o suru desu ka? - Does Chris do judo?

Kyou, Kyle ha dojo he kuru desu ka? - Will Kyle come to the dojo today?


//Advanced Questions

If you're using the question words nani, or doko, the subject goes before the question word.

Anata ha doko he iku desu ka? - Where will you go?

Kyle ha nani o taberu desu ka? - What will Kyle eat?

Kyou nani o suru desu ka? - What will you do today? (What are you doing today?)
